package com.siyeh.ig.threading;
import com.intellij.codeInspection.ProblemDescriptor;
import com.intellij.openapi.project.Project;
import com.intellij.psi.*;
import com.intellij.psi.util.InheritanceUtil;
import com.intellij.psi.util.PsiTreeUtil;
import com.intellij.util.IncorrectOperationException;
import com.siyeh.HardcodedMethodConstants;
import com.siyeh.InspectionGadgetsBundle;
import com.siyeh.ig.BaseInspection;
import com.siyeh.ig.BaseInspectionVisitor;
import com.siyeh.ig.InspectionGadgetsFix;
import com.siyeh.ig.PsiReplacementUtil;
import org.jetbrains.annotations.NotNull;
public class ThreadRunInspection extends BaseInspection {
@Override
@NotNull
public String getDisplayName() {
return InspectionGadgetsBundle.message("thread.run.display.name");
}
@Override
@NotNull
public String getID() {
return "CallToThreadRun";
}
@Override
@NotNull
protected String buildErrorString(Object... infos) {
return InspectionGadgetsBundle.message("thread.run.problem.descriptor");
}
@Override
public InspectionGadgetsFix buildFix(Object... infos) {
return new ThreadRunFix();
}
private static class ThreadRunFix extends InspectionGadgetsFix {
@Override
@NotNull
public String getName() {
return InspectionGadgetsBundle.message(
"thread.run.replace.quickfix");
}
@NotNull
@Override
public String getFamilyName() {
return getName();
}
@Override
public void doFix(@NotNull Project project, ProblemDescriptor descriptor)
throws IncorrectOperationException {
final PsiElement methodNameIdentifier = descriptor.getPsiElement();
final PsiReferenceExpression methodExpression =
(PsiReferenceExpression)methodNameIdentifier.getParent();
assert methodExpression != null;
final PsiExpression qualifier =
methodExpression.getQualifierExpression();
if (qualifier == null) {
PsiReplacementUtil.replaceExpression(methodExpression, "start");
}
else {
final String qualifierText = qualifier.getText();
PsiReplacementUtil.replaceExpression(methodExpression, qualifierText + ".start");
}
}
}
@Override
public BaseInspectionVisitor buildVisitor() {
return new ThreadRunVisitor();
}
private static class ThreadRunVisitor extends BaseInspectionVisitor {
@Override
public void visitMethodCallExpression(
@NotNull PsiMethodCallExpression expression) {
super.visitMethodCallExpression(expression);
final PsiReferenceExpression methodExpression =
expression.getMethodExpression();
final String methodName = methodExpression.getReferenceName();
if (!HardcodedMethodConstants.RUN.equals(methodName)) {
return;
}
final PsiMethod method = expression.resolveMethod();
if (method == null) {
return;
}
final PsiParameterList parameterList = method.getParameterList();
if (parameterList.getParametersCount() != 0) {
return;
}
final PsiClass methodClass = method.getContainingClass();
if (methodClass == null) {
return;
}
if (!InheritanceUtil.isInheritor(methodClass, "java.lang.Thread")) {
return;
}
if (isInsideThreadRun(expression)) {
return;
}
registerMethodCallError(expression);
}
private static boolean isInsideThreadRun(
PsiElement element) {
final PsiMethod method =
PsiTreeUtil.getParentOfType(element, PsiMethod.class);
if (method == null) {
return false;
}
final String methodName = method.getName();
if (!HardcodedMethodConstants.RUN.equals(methodName)) {
return false;
}
final PsiClass methodClass = method.getContainingClass();
if (methodClass == null) {
return false;
}
return InheritanceUtil.isInheritor(methodClass, "java.lang.Thread");
}
}
}
